NASA's Artemis II Moon Rocket Fully Integrated
NASA's Artemis II Moon Rocket Fully Integrated | Kennedy Space CenterNASA’s Artemis II Orion crew spacecraft with its launch abort system was recently stacked atop the agency’s Space Launch System (SLS) rocket in High Bay 3 of the Vehicle Assembly Building (VAB) at NASA's Kennedy Space Center (KSC) in Florida. This milestone marks a huge step in the mission that will carry four astronauts on a 10-day mission around the Moon and back in early 202…
